Any sidewall repairs are not allowed. Looks to me like a repair would be possible assuming no inner sidewall damage as Mikey said. The repair should be done using a mushroom style patch that will fill the hole made by the screw so no worry about it leaving a hole in the tread and the patch will be cold vulcanised to the inside.
